+/**
+ * gdbstub_exit - Send an exit message to GDB
+ * @status: The exit code to report.
+ */
+void gdbstub_exit(int status)
+{
+ unsigned char checksum, ch, buffer[3];
+ int loop;
+
+ if (!kgdb_connected)
+ return;
+ kgdb_connected = 0;
+
+ if (!dbg_io_ops || dbg_kdb_mode)
+ return;
+
+ buffer[0] = 'W';
+ buffer[1] = hex_asc_hi(status);
+ buffer[2] = hex_asc_lo(status);
+
+ dbg_io_ops->write_char('$');
+ checksum = 0;
+
+ for (loop = 0; loop < 3; loop++) {
+ ch = buffer[loop];
+ checksum += ch;
+ dbg_io_ops->write_char(ch);
+ }
+
+ dbg_io_ops->write_char('#');
+ dbg_io_ops->write_char(hex_asc_hi(checksum));
+ dbg_io_ops->write_char(hex_asc_lo(checksum));
+
+ /* make sure the output is flushed, lest the bootloader clobber it */
+ if (dbg_io_ops->flush)
+ dbg_io_ops->flush();
+}
